The global electric vehicle (EV) market has kicked off 2025 with an impressive surge, recording an 18% increase in sales in January compared to the previous year. Global EV Sales Growth: Key Insights According to Reuters ( Source ), global EV sales rose by 18% in January 2025, with notable growth in the U.S.

Mitsubishi Motors Corporation (MMC) announced that the world’s first plug-in hybrid SUV, the Mitsubishi Outlander PHEV, has achieved sales of 200,000 units worldwide since its launch in 2013. Since making its debut in Japan, the Outlander PHEV has been rolled out to more than 50 countries across the world. liter gasoline engine.

Lexus announced that the luxury brand eclipsed the milestone of 2 million globalsales of electrified vehicles—hybrids and battery-electric—at the end of April 2021. In 2020, 33% of the Lexus models sold globally were of the electrified variety. its lineup of electrified vehicles to provide a wide range of options.
